mutter (48.7-0+deb13u1) trixie; urgency=medium
|
||||
|
||||
* Team upload
|
||||
* New upstream stable release 48.6
|
||||
- Fix drag-and-drop actions not working reliably in some X11 clients
|
||||
(mutter#4288 upstream)
|
||||
- Fix delayed frame presentation with the commit-timing-v1 Wayland
|
||||
extension (mutter#4258 upstream)
|
||||
- Avoid a crash if a GNOME Shell extension tries to delete the same
|
||||
window more than once (mutter#4319 upstream)
|
||||
- Avoid a crash in the Wayland session if a non-GNOME desktop
|
||||
environment previously set the cursor size in GSettings to zero;
|
||||
recover by resetting it to the default, 24px (mutter#3933 upstream)
|
||||
- Fix crashes if a GNOME Shell extension uses certain Cogl pipeline
|
||||
APIs (mutter#4352 upstream)
|
||||
- Save the intended size for tiled windows when saving session state
|
||||
(mutter!4697 upstream)
|
||||
- Avoid potential crashes when saving the state of a window with no
|
||||
valid toplevel state (mutter!4697 upstream)
|
||||
- Remove dead code detected by static analysis (mutter!4697 upstream)
|
||||
* New upstream stable release 48.7
|
||||
- For fullscreen Wayland windows, if the window has a size limit
|
||||
smaller than the screen, add black borders around the limited size
|
||||
and log a warning
|
||||
(mutter!4587 upstream)
|
||||
- Avoid a crash when activating a notification that has no app info
|
||||
(mutter!4705 upstream)
|
||||
- Avoid a potential crash when checking whether a client owns a window
|
||||
that is disappearing
|
||||
(mutter!4643 upstream)

mutter (48.5-1) unstable; urgency=medium
|
||||
|
||||
* Team upload
|
||||
* New upstream stable release
|
||||
- Fix X11 drag-and-drop with a graphics tablet stylus, which would
|
||||
previously freeze the application
|
||||
(mutter#3914 upstream)
|
||||
- Fix a file descriptor leak that would cause a crash after a long
|
||||
screencast
|
||||
(mutter#4251 upstream, Closes: #1121170)
|
||||
- Fix crash with an assertion failure when screencasting from an
|
||||
Apple aarch64 system
|
||||
(mutter#4224 upstream)
|
||||
- Fix detection of the "Privacy Screen" feature on hardware that
|
||||
supports it
|
||||
(mutter#4259 upstream)
|
||||
- Update the EIS viewport used for input capture when a virtual monitor
|
||||
stream is resized
|
||||
(mutter!4622 upstream)
|
||||
- Fix a crash when combining the screen time limit's greyscale effect,
|
||||
the screen magnifier and the screenshot tool
|
||||
(mutter#8634 upstream)
|
||||
- Fix a crash when unplugging a docking station with two monitors
|
||||
(mutter#4262 upstream)
